package com.smartor.domain; import java.util.Date; import com.fasterxml.jackson.annotation.JsonFormat; import io.swagger.annotations.ApiModel; import io.swagger.annotations.ApiModelProperty; import lombok.Data; import org.apache.commons.lang3.builder.ToStringBuilder; import org.apache.commons.lang3.builder.ToStringStyle; import com.ruoyi.common.annotation.Excel; import com.ruoyi.common.core.domain.BaseEntity; /** * 话术模板库对象 ivr_liba_template * * @author smartor * @date 2023-03-22 */ @Data @ApiModel(value = "IvrLibaTemplate", description = "话术模板库对象") public class IvrLibaTemplate extends BaseEntity { private static final long serialVersionUID = 1L; /** * $column.columnComment */ @ApiModelProperty(value = "模板id") private String templateID; /** * $column.columnComment */ @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") @ApiModelProperty(value = "模板名称") private String templateName; /** * $column.columnComment */ @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") @ApiModelProperty(value = "silencetime") private Long silencetime; /** * $column.columnComment */ @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") @ApiModelProperty(value = "slienceRepeatTimes") private Long slienceRepeatTimes; /** * $column.columnComment */ @ApiModelProperty(value = "nomatchRepeatTimes")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private Long nomatchRepeatTimes; /** * $column.columnComment */ @ApiModelProperty(value = "firstQuestionNum")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private Long firstQuestionNum; /** * $column.columnComment */ @ApiModelProperty(value = "子组件")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private String submodule; /** * $column.columnComment */ @ApiModelProperty(value = "语言")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private String language; /** * $column.columnComment */ @ApiModelProperty(value = "描述") @Excel(name = "${note}", readConverterExp = "$column.readConverterExp()") private String note; /** * $column.columnComment */ @ApiModelProperty(value = "isEnable")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private Long isEnable; /** * $column.columnComment */ @ApiModelProperty(value = "添加人")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private String addUserID; /** * $column.columnComment */ @ApiModelProperty(value = "添加时间")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private Date addTime; /** * $column.columnComment */ @ApiModelProperty(value = "修改人id")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private String modifyUserID; /** * $column.columnComment */ @ApiModelProperty(value = "修改时间")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private Date modifyTime; /** * $column.columnComment */ @ApiModelProperty(value = "分组id")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private String groupID; /** * $column.columnComment */ @ApiModelProperty(value = "标签信息")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private String labelInfo; /** * $column.columnComment */ @ApiModelProperty(value = "模板id")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private String submoduleID; /** * 播报类型 0.语音优先 1.文字优先 */ @ApiModelProperty(value = "播报类型 0.语音优先 1.文字优先") @Excel(name = "播报类型 0.语音优先 1.文字优先") private Long playType; /** * $column.columnComment */ @ApiModelProperty(value = "icd10code")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private String icd10code; /** * $column.columnComment */ @ApiModelProperty(value = "icd10codename")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private String icd10codename; /** * $column.columnComment */ @ApiModelProperty(value = "atuoTaskDayOffset")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private Long atuoTaskDayOffset; /** * $column.columnComment */ @ApiModelProperty(value = "部门id")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private String deptIds; /** * $column.columnComment */ @ApiModelProperty(value = "部门名称")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private String deptNames; /** * $column.columnComment */ @ApiModelProperty(value = "fKsdm") @Excel(name = "${comment}", readConverterExp = "$column.readConverterExp()") private String fKsdm; /** * 删除标记 */ @ApiModelProperty(value = "删除标记") private String delFlag; /** * 上传标记 */ @ApiModelProperty(value = "上传标记") @Excel(name = " 上传标记 ") private Long isupload; /** * 上传时间 */ @ApiModelProperty(value = "上传时间") @JsonFormat(pattern = "yyyy-MM-dd") @Excel(name = " 上传时间 ", width = 30, dateFormat = "yyyy-MM-dd") private Date uploadTime; /** * 机构ID */ @ApiModelProperty(value = "机构ID") @Excel(name = " 机构ID ") private String orgid; /** * 上传标记 */ @ApiModelProperty(value = "分类id") @Excel(name = " 分类id ") private Long assortid; }